Public Hearing: Proposed acceptance of Cotton Lane into parish road system
The Claiborne Parish Police Jury has called a public hearing to request input from the public about its proposed inclusion and acceptance of the Cotton Lane (Parish Road #512) into the Claiborne Parish Road System. Quitman High School senior Laura Arnold named 2024 Congressional Art Competition Winner
Start, Louisiana - Congresswoman Julia Letlow announced Laura Arnold as the winner of the 2024 Congressional Art Competition from the Fifth District of Louisiana. A recent graduate of Quitman High School, Laura won the competition with a collage entitled "Chicken Bits." The collage features an image of a hen as the focal point made from blue, orange, and brown collage pieces.
Louisiana Legends Fest coming to downtown Homer this fall
HOMER, La. - The Louisiana Legends Fest will be held Oct. 19 in downtown Homer from 9 a.m. to 6 p.m. The annual festival will cover an eleven-block area centered around the historic Claiborne Parish Courthouse.
